In the 400 years after Rome, lemon trees reached the Mediterranean and were introduced to Italy circa 200 AD. Despite all this, it’s believed lemons weren’t used in cooking. The origin of the lemon is unknown, though lemons are thought to have first grown in Assam (a region in northeast India), northern Myanmar or China. A genomic study of the lemon indicated it was a hybrid between bitter orange (sour orange) and citron. Lemons are supposed to have entered Europe near southern Italy no later than …

WebMar 3, 2024 · Meaning. The meaning of the proverb, “when life gives you lemons,” is to overcome your problems and look for a solution. It’s an encouraging phrase meant to change a person’s or the speaker’s mindset to a positive state where they can look past the misfortune in their life. The lemon in the phrase refers to the bitterness of the problem. WebSep 17, 2024 · The Lemon (Citrus limon) is a species of small evergreen tree in the flowering plant family Rutaceae.
